Cooking Instructions
- 1
Brown the stewing steak, add onion, carrot, parsnip and leeks, leave to fry for 5 mins. Add tomato puree and stir. Add water to just cover the meat and veg.
- 2
Leave until it comes to the boil add potatoes fill water until it covers. Add 2 stock cubes. Simmer for 1-2 hours.
- 3
Add cabbage after few hours, and 2 more stock cubes, add gravy to slightly thicken, serve

Scouse Scouse
Scouse is a traditional dish from the city of Liverpool, aside from The Beatles, and football, it's what the city is famous for, so much so that people from Liverpool are known colloquially as Scousers!It originated from the sailors who used the port, and over the centuries has been adopted by by the locals and made their own. Traditionally a working class dish, their is no definitive recipe it tended to be made with leftovers or whatever was in the house.
